WARTICON Topical cream Ref.[8350] Active ingredients: Podophyllotoxin

Source: Medicines & Healthcare Products Regulatory Agency (GB)  Revision Year: 2019  Publisher: Phoenix Labs, Suite 12, Bunkilla Plaza, Bracetown Business Park, Clonee, County Meath, IRELAND

Therapeutic indications

Route of administration: Topical.

For the topical treatment of condylomata acuminata affecting the penis or the external female genitalia.

Posology and method of administration

The affected area should be thoroughly washed with soap and water, and dried prior to application.

Using a fingertip, the cream should be applied twice daily morning and evening (every 12 hours) for 3 consecutive days using only enough cream to just cover each wart. The cream should then be withheld for the next 4 consecutive days.

Application to the surrounding normal tissue should be avoided.

Residual warts should be treated with further courses of twice daily applications for three days at weekly intervals, if necessary for a total of 4 weeks of treatment.

Hands should be washed thoroughly after application.

Paediatric population

The safety and efficacy of topical podophyllotoxin have not been established in children under the age of 18.

Overdose

While serious systemic effects have not been reported with the recommended dosage of topical podophyllotoxin, topical overdosage would be expected to increase systemic absorption of the drug and increase the potential for systemic effects, e.g. altered mental state and bone marrow suppression. Following oral ingestion, podophyllotoxin may also cause severe gastroenteritis.

Treatment

If topical overdosage occurs, podophyllotoxin should be washed immediately from the treatment area and symptomatic and supportive therapy initiated.

Treatment of oral podophyllotoxin poisoning is symptomatic and should include supportive care.

Further management should be as clinically indicated or as recommended by the National Poisons Centre, where available.

Shelf life

2 years.

Special precautions for storage

This medicinal product does not require any special storage conditions.

Nature and contents of container

A collapsible aluminium tube with imperforate nozzle membrane and internally coated with a protective lacquer. Tube cap of polyethylene with a spike on the upper end aimed to perforate the membrane when opening the tube for the first time. Size 5g and 10g.
